At LiveBeyond, we believe community development demands a holistic approach. This is why we have chosen to address core needs to eradicate poverty and promote sustainable communities in and around Thomazeau, Haiti.
Medical Care: Providing quality medical care to those who had no access to healthcare.
Maternal & Infant Health: Caring for vulnerable women and infants during pregnancy, childbirth, and infancy.
Education: Equipping future leaders through quality education and school programs.
Special Needs Education: Empowering children with special needs to learn alongside peers.
Clean Water: Providing over 900,000 gallons of clean water per day.
Food Security: Providing over 3,000 meals per weekday to mothers, children and families.
Spiritual Guidance: Inspiring hope for the future through scripture, prayer and discipleship training.
Our mission is to create sustainable communities that fully operate through local people and resources. As of 2019, that vision was realized and we are thrilled with the results. Our methodology has taken years to develop, and we are happy to say that the community in Thomazeau is thriving independent of a full-time American staff, despite the turmoil that has stricken the rest of Haiti.
